Sika Boom-553 Low Expansion is a single-component, self-expanding polyurethane foam for application by gun.
It is ideal for filling connecting joints around window and door frames, as it has low subsequent expansion as well as low expansive pressure.
EC 1 PLUS label: very low VOC emissions.

Areas of application
The product is designed to:
- Insulation and filling of cavities and voids
- Filling the joints around window and door frames
- Insulation against cold and drafts
- Filling around pipes/conduit penetrations
The product can be used for indoor and outdoor applications.
Application
- Pre-moisten the surface with clean water.
This ensures that the foam polymerizes correctly and prevents unwanted expansion of the foam. - Shake the aerosol can well at least 20 times before use.
Note: Repeat the shaking after long interruptions during use. - Remove the aerosol can cap.
- Screw the aerosol can onto the threads of the application gun.
- Dispense the foam by pressing the trigger.
IMPORTANT: To ensure proper flow, hold the aerosol upside down during dispensing.
Note: The amount of foam extruded can be adjusted by applying more or less pressure to the trigger or by using the flow adjustment screw on the application gun. - Fill the deep joints in several layers.
IMPORTANT: Allow each layer to expand and harden sufficiently before wetting it again with water for the application of the next layer.
Note: Only partially fill voids/cavities as the foam expands during hardening.
Small gaps can be filled using an extension tube, although this will reduce the foam flow rate.
Consumption
Joint yield based on a 20 mm × 50 mm joint
Foam yield: ~49 liters
Yield per joint: ~30 m

FAQ - Frequently Asked Questions
- What is the difference between low-expansion foam and standard foam?
Low-expansion foam expands much less during application. This prevents deformation of sensitive surfaces such as frames, unlike standard, more expansive foams. - Can Sika Boom-553 foam be used to fix windows?
Yes, that's actually one of its main applications. Its low expansion ensures a clean seal without excessive pressure. - Does the foam adhere to damp surfaces?
Slight humidity promotes hardening, but surfaces should not be wet or dripping. - Can you paint the foam once it's dry?
Yes, once completely hardened and sanded if necessary, it can be painted or coated. - What is the total curing time?
The surface typically hardens in 5 to 10 minutes, and complete hardening occurs after 12 to 24 hours depending on conditions. - Is the foam water-resistant?
It is moisture resistant once hardened, but it is advisable to protect the foam outdoors with a suitable coating or sealant. - Is it suitable for soundproofing?
Yes, its fine-cell structure offers good sound absorption in gaps and cavities.
